To the dispatch desk: The sealed-bid tender envelope for the Marrowgate depot works is ready at the front office. It must reach the Pellworth council building before Thursday noon, unopened, with the seal photographed at both ends of the journey. No substitution of couriers once booked; the same driver handles the full run. At hand-over, relay this instruction to the driver exactly as written:

dispatch memo: the eliok quenok courier leaves the sorael aldath belion tammir casix gileth queniel jorath ledger at gate 9299 under passcode 897989

The bucketing logic is sound: stable hash of user key plus experiment salt, modulo the resolution, compared against cumulative arm weights. One concern is that the rebalance path recomputes assignments eagerly, which could churn sticky sessions; suggest gating that behind the existing freeze flag. Cache TTLs and retry behavior look fine but are now load-bearing, so any change should go through review. For reference, the constants driving bucket resolution and cache behavior are listed here.

tuning table, hafog-bahaf:
QUOTAS = {
    "praion": 144,
    "briax": 906,
    "silwyn": 451,
}

Subject: Sprigly scheduler ownership change

Hi all,

A quick note for those joining this sprint: responsibility for the Sprigly plant-watering scheduler has moved teams. That covers the cron definitions, the moisture-threshold config, and the retry logic when a valve fails to acknowledge. Open tickets have been triaged and reassigned already, so nothing is in limbo. For design questions, schedule changes, or incident escalation, the new owner is listed below.

named custodian: Brivan Eliath Quenox Frador

Handover for the weekly sync: the Chirpstream ingestion service is still way too chatty, so I bumped log sampling from 1:10 to 1:100 on info-level lines and left errors unsampled. Dashboards in Lodestone were rebuilt against the sampled stream, so the counts look lower — that's expected, not an outage. If volume creeps back up, the sampler config lives in the chirpstream-ops repo under sampling.yaml. Alert thresholds were rescaled already. Questions on tuning or rollback should go to the person named below.

account owner for bawip-tahag: Raleth Quenok